Instrument
Theory: Monochromatic wavelength dispersive X-ray fluorescence spectroscopy (WDXRF)
Application: Analyzing sulfur content in fuel down to 0.2 ppm LOD, compliant with ASTM D7039, ASTM D2622, ISO 20884, SH/T 0842
X-ray Source
Micro-focus X-ray tube (focus spot 175 µm, target Cr, Be window 100 µm)
Optics
Johansson-type DCC for monochromatic excitation and characteristic X-ray detection
Vacuum chamber XFS (X-ray Fixed System)
Detection
Sealed proportional counter (25.4 µm Be window)
Digital shaping, high-speed multi-channel pulse height analyzer
Software
High-speed processor or embedded system platform
Touch-pad with graphical user interface
Functions include calibration, drift correction, routine testing, data browsing, data printing, statistical analysis and data transfer
Environmental Requirement
Room temperature: 15–30°C
Relative humidity <80%
Parameters
LOD: 0.2 ppm at 300 s
Range: 0.2 ppm–10%
Measuring time: 30–300 s
Standard error: Sn-1 <0.2 ppm (2 ppm), 0.4 ppm (10 ppm), 2.5 ppm (50 ppm)
Power Requirement
AC 220–240 V, 5A
Rated power: 500 W
Johansson-Type DCC
Monochromatic WDXRF using double curved crystal optics has the advantage of very high sensitivity for a specific sample element of interest.
The primary Johannson-Type DCC focusing optic captures a narrow bandwidth of X rays from the source and focuses this intense monochromatic beam to a small spot on the sample. The monochromatic primary beam excites the sample and secondary characteristic fluorescence X-rays are emitted.
The second Johannson-Type DCC collects only select characteristic X-ray wavelengths of interest within a narrow bandwidth
XFS (X-Ray Fixed System)
The optics system is carefully adjusted in the factory with special facilities and locked tightly on its proper position.
High precision optics
All core optic units were manufactured with CMC facilities. No moving parts and no slit switching optics in the whole instrument, to ensure the long term reliability.
High Integration
Digital Multi-Channel Analyzer
High precision digital pulse shaping and digital pulse height analyzer based on FPGA; implement fast baseline restoration and best peak detection function
